Offset Frequency Define
Allows you to select “Offset” definition:
CTOCenter
From the lowermost carrier center frequency (for lower offset), the uppermost carrier center frequency
(for upper offset) to the center frequency of each Offset Integ BW
CTOEdge
From the lowermost carrier center frequency (for lower offset), the uppermost carrier center frequency
(for upper offset) to the closest edge frequency of each Offset Integ BW
ETOCenter
From the lowermost carrier center frequency - spacing of this carrier /2 (for lower offset), the
uppermost carrier center frequency + spacing of this carrier /2 (for upper offset) to the center
frequency of each Offset Integ BW
ETOEdge
From the lowermost carrier center frequency - spacing of this carrier /2 (for lower offset), the
uppermost carrier center frequency + spacing of this carrier /2 (for upper offset) to the closest edge
frequency of each Offset Integ BW
STOCenter
From either the lower or upper sub-block edge frequency to the center frequency of each Offset Integ
BW
STOEdge
From either the lower or upper sub-block edge frequency to the closest edge frequency of each Offset
Integ BW
